Introduction of Tooth Substitute Options
When you lose a tooth, it's crucial to discover your substitute alternatives to maintain your oral health and wellness and smile. Several options are offered, each with its benefits and drawbacks.
One preferred alternative is dentures, which are detachable devices that can change multiple missing teeth. They're usually more economical upfront and can be a fast service. Nonetheless, they may not fit securely and can in some cases create pain.
Bridges are one more choice, containing crowns put on surrounding teeth to sustain a prosthetic tooth. They're taken care of in place, offering a more all-natural feel than dentures, however need modification of healthy and balanced teeth and may not last as long as other methods.
Then there are dental implants, which entail surgically placing a titanium article right into your jawbone. They provide a long-term service that resembles natural teeth carefully. Implants support bone health and wellness and don't need altering adjacent teeth.
Inevitably, your option will certainly depend upon your certain demands, choices, and oral health and wellness. Consider speaking with your dental expert to talk about which alternative ideal matches your situation and way of life.
Expense Failure of Oral Implants
Oral implants are usually viewed as a costs tooth substitute option, and understanding their expense can help you make an educated decision.
The total cost of oral implants differs based on several elements, including the intricacy of your instance, the number of implants required, and the place of the dental practice.
Usually, you might anticipate to pay between $3,000 and $4,500 per implant. This cost generally consists of the implant itself, the abutment (the port piece), and the crown that sits on top.
Nonetheless, extra expenses can arise. For instance, if you require bone grafts or sinus lifts to guarantee correct placement, these treatments can add anywhere from $300 to $3,000 to your general prices.
Don't ignore the initial examination and imaging, which may range from $100 to $500, depending on the diagnostic devices utilized.
Likewise, bear in mind to take into consideration potential follow-up check outs and upkeep. By breaking down these costs, you'll acquire a clearer picture of the economic dedication associated with choosing dental implants, assisting you evaluate your choices better.
Long-term Expenditures of Alternatives
Exploring tooth substitute alternatives usually exposes that choices to dental implants can bring about considerable lasting expenditures.
While choices like dentures or bridges could seem less costly upfront, they frequently feature concealed expenses that can accumulate gradually.
For example, dentures call for routine adjustments and substitutes, typically every five to seven years. Each modification adds to your total cost, as well as the capacity for fixings if they end up being damaged.
